I have been a samsung user for a few years now and currently have a note 20. Although it is a great phone I am very disappointed with the camera on this model it is laggy constantly captures people with their eyes closed mid blink overall image quality isn't great.video seems grainy unless it's excellent outdoor lighting. I'm very disappointed in the camera in what is supposed to be a high end phone. I'm thinking of switching to apple for my next phone just for the camera. Do apple have better cameras?will I see a noticeable difference or will I just be wasting my money as its the cost of iphones which is kind of putting me off. Anyone had experience of using cameras on both phones?
